#OLD4. 保护地球,你有责

保护地球,你有责

Description

在虚拟世界里,怪兽占据了地球的整个领土,严重威胁了富强民主文明和谐自由平等公正法治社会,为解决这个问题,国家决定发明一个终极武器,消灭怪兽。由于经费有限,你只有x个设备需要完美的安排在L个地点,使两个设备间的最小距离尽可能大。

Format

Input

第一行输入L(2<=L<=1e6)个地点和你拥有的设备数x(2<=x<=L)

第二行输入L(0<=Li<=1e6)个地点的地理位置,其中地点以行排列

Output

输出一个整数表示最大化的两个设备之间的最下距离

Samples

5 3 
2 3 9 6 11
4
4 3
1 4 9 10
3

Hint

第一个样例中你可以把武器安置在2 6 11点